What is the weather like in the Soča Valley in February?
The Soča Valley is a region in Slovenia. February in the Soča Valley generally has cold temperatures, with high precipitation. February is a winter month.
Temperatures
You can expect cold maximum daytime temperatures of around 5°C and nighttime temperatures around -4°C in Bovec. Precipitation
In February, precipitation varies across different areas. From high snow/rainfall in Bovec with an average of 105 mm to high snow/rainfall in Tolmin with 113 mm.Average sunshine

Popular destinations
What is the weather like in February for the 3 most popular destinations in the Soča Valley?
Bovec
In February Bovec generally has low temperatures with maximum daytime temperatures around 5°C, minimum nighttime temperatures around -4°C and high monthly snow/rainfall. So on average the conditions are poor that month.
Kobarid
In February Kobarid generally has low temperatures with maximum daytime temperatures around 6°C, minimum nighttime temperatures around -3°C and high monthly snow/rainfall. So on average the conditions are poor that month.
Tolmin
In February Tolmin generally has low temperatures with maximum daytime temperatures around 6°C, minimum nighttime temperatures around -3°C and high monthly snow/rainfall. So on average the conditions are poor that month.

Is February the best time to visit the Soča Valley?
Given the typically poor weather conditions in Bovec, February may not be the ideal time to visit the Soča Valley.
On average, the best time to visit the Soča Valley is in June, July and August with generally pleasant weather in Bovec. In contrast, January, February, March, October, November and December tend to have poor weather conditions.
